JCB International signs new license agreement with United
Overseas Bank for further enhancement of JCB Card acceptance
in Singapore

Tokyo, January 29, 2008 - JCB International (JCBI), JCB’s international subsidiary, announced today a new agreement with United Overseas Bank (UOB) to expand JCB card acceptance in Singapore. In mid-2008, UOB will start opening its merchant network, the largest in Singapore, to JCB cards. With this agreement, JCB cardmembers traveling and dwelling in the country will enjoy a significant increase of convenience in using their JCB card.

Mr. Akira Matsuo, Senior Vice President of JCB International Asia Pacific, said that Singapore will remain a popular destination especially for Asian travelers with new tourist attractions such as Formula One racing, integrated resorts, as well as new mega malls. “Singapore is one of the top destinations for both business and pleasure because it is located in the center of Asia and so has easy access to the other countries and territories in the region, and the city also offers excellent facilities, fascinating cultural contrasts and numerous tourist attractions.”

“In the past, JCBI has been directly acquiring JCB merchants in Singapore”, said Mr. Matsuo. “To respond to fast changing trends and customer needs, it has become essential for us to work with local acquirers. We chose UOB as our first acquiring partner, due to its position as a leading company in the credit card business in Singapore. JCBI has had a relationship based on mutual trust with UOB since 1990 for processing JCB card transactions, and since 1993 for issuing JCB cards. I am confident that the increasing numbers of UOB merchants will provide JCB cardmembers with greater convenience. And in return, those merchants will also benefit from sales generated by JCB’s solid cardmember base in Asia." Mr. Matsuo added.
